For some, this season is filled with warmth, laughter, and traditions that feel grounding. And for others, it carries quiet grief, longing, or the weight of what’s missing. For many, it’s both joy and sorrow living side by side.

My wish for you 🎄:

If you’re celebrating, may the moments feel sweet and steady.

If you’re grieving, may you feel held in your tenderness.

If you’re simply surviving the day, that it feels like enough.

You don’t have to perform gratitude. You don’t have to make meaning.You don’t have to feel any certain way for this season to be valid.

As we move toward a new year, let it be gentle. Let it meet you where you are not where you think you should be.

However the holidays land in your body and heart, you are not alone. We see you. We honor you. And we’re holding space for you…ALL of you.

🚨 We’re bringing you another necessary discussion!

The holidays can be one of the most emotionally challenging times for anyone navigating fertility struggles or recovering from pregnancy loss. Between pregnancy announcements, family gatherings, and the constant questions of “When are you having a baby?”This season can feel isolating, triggering, and overwhelming.

In this Instagram Live, Dr. Carolina Amaya (Fertility Acupuncturist) and Vanessa Woods (Therapist & Practice Owner) will have an honest, compassionate conversation about the emotional weight fertility patients carry during the holidays. We’ll talk about grief, comparison, boundaries, and how to protect your mental and emotional well-being when the world feels loud and insensitive.

Dr. Amaya will also explain how acupuncture supports fertility in complex cases, including infertility, recurrent loss, and nervous system dysregulation , especially during periods of high emotional stress. Vanessa will share a therapist’s perspective on coping, grounding, and self-compassion during a season that can feel anything but peaceful.

This conversation is for anyone who has ever smiled through pain, shown up while hurting, or wondered how to survive the holidays while honoring their own journey.

About Us

Both Vanessa and Elrita have been practicing in mental health for many year. Their combined experience adds 25 plus years of insight, knowledge, empathy, and compassion to SJCC. To the core, they believe that education, empowerment, authenticity, and vision are the most impactful tools to help facilitate and cultivate a climate of change. They believe that healing is a holistic process that starts in the mind. Through much discussion and excitment for ways to add innovative ways to reach and help heal their clients South Jersey Coping Clinic was established.
